Handover note — Fennick to Oriol, Lanternwell catalogue import. The MARC-record importer for the Thistledown Library Consortium runs nightly on the Copperline host; validation failures quarantine to a sealed bucket. All credentials were rotated on handover per security policy. The encrypted importer keystore can only be unlocked with the recovery passphrase recorded directly below this line.

vault phrase of kawep-tahog = ulaix-briath

// Sweep interval for the Grubel orphaned-resource sweeper.
// Raised from 300s to 900s after the sweeper reclaimed
// volumes still referenced by in-flight restores (incident GR-19).
// Do not lower without sign-off; the restore service needs
// headroom to register claims. Release managers: this constant
// is frozen for the current train. Change history is pinned
// to the build token noted below.

build token for kagaf-hahof: htk14_9d3d4d26d7d8de

## Relevance Tuning: Stale Synonym Cache

If Quillsearch returns outdated synonym expansions after a dictionary update, first confirm the tuning service reloaded its config by checking the reindex timestamp in the admin panel. New hires: never edit boost weights directly in production. To replay queries against the staging ranker, authenticate with the token below.

session JWT of tadup-kaguf = eyJhbGciOiJIUzI1NiIsInR5cCI6IkpXVCJ9.eyJzdWIiOiItNz4V3In0.KrZCeqpk